Sustainable Materials



When planning your green shower room remodel, consider using lasting products to minimize your ecological influence. Selecting lasting products not just minimizes the deficiency of natural resources however likewise helps in creating a healthier indoor setting for you and your family members.

Among the first sustainable products you can use is bamboo. Bamboo is a fast-growing turf that can be harvested and restored promptly. It's solid, resilient, and can be utilized for flooring, kitchen counters, and also as a product for bathroom devices like tooth brush holders and soap meals.

One more lasting material to consider is recycled glass. Recycled glass can be transformed into beautiful ceramic tiles for your shower room wall surfaces or floor covering. It not only includes an one-of-a-kind touch to your restroom layout but likewise lowers the quantity of waste that ends up in garbage dumps. Additionally, recycled glass needs much less power to generate contrasted to virgin glass.

You can also choose to make use of redeemed wood for your bathroom remodel. Redeemed timber is restored from old structures, barns, or factories and repurposed for brand-new use. It adds heat and character to your shower room while decreasing the demand for new timber.

Energy-Efficient Fixtures



To further decrease your environmental influence and develop an energy-efficient restroom, think about upgrading to energy-efficient components. These components not just assist you reduce power prices but also add to a greener earth.

Here are five energy-efficient components to think about for your restroom remodel:

- LED Lighting: Change conventional incandescent light bulbs with energy-efficient LED lights. They take in much less power, last much longer, and provide brilliant illumination.

- Low-Flow Showerheads: Install low-flow showerheads to lower water usage while keeping a refreshing shower experience.

- Dual-Flush Toilets: Upgrade to dual-flush commodes that use the option of a full flush for strong waste and a partial flush for liquid waste, saving water with each use.

- Motion-Sensor Faucets: Opt for motion-sensor taps that immediately shut off when not being used, avoiding water wastage.

- Energy-Efficient Air Flow Followers: Mount energy-efficient air flow followers that get rid of excess wetness from the restroom while utilizing less electricity.

Water Conservation Methods



Consider implementing water conservation strategies to reduce water waste and promote lasting practices in your bathroom remodel.

By taking on these approaches, you can help reduce your water usage and add to the preservation of this valuable resource.

One efficient approach is to mount low-flow components, such as low-flow bathrooms and showerheads. These components are made to limit water circulation, without endangering on performance. By using much less water per flush or shower, you can significantly lower your water use.

An additional water conservation strategy is to deal with any type of leaks in your shower room. Also small leaks can add up to a considerable amount of water waste gradually. Regularly look for leaks in your faucets, pipelines, and commodes, and repair them quickly to stop unnecessary water loss.

Furthermore, take into consideration applying a greywater system in your washroom remodel. Greywater refers to the reasonably tidy wastewater from showers, bathtubs, and sinks. By installing a greywater system, you can catch and reuse this water for purposes like purging commodes or watering plants. This not just decreases water consumption yet also assists prevent contamination by drawing away wastewater away from sewer system.

Lastly, practicing conscious water usage habits can make a large difference. Easy actions like shutting off the faucet while cleaning your teeth or taking much shorter showers can considerably reduce water waste.
